前几篇文章,已经安装了SharePoint 2010,今天将演示如何配置传出邮件。由于某些原因,企业可能没有安装自己邮件服务器,此时我们可以使用公共的邮箱服务来发送邮件通知,比如outlook.com,gmail等,今天主要从outlook为例子,其它邮件服务的配置大同小异。

由于公共邮件服务器一般都不允许匿名访问,但SharePoint的传出邮件却只能使用匿名的SMTP服务器。因为我们必须安装一个自己的SMTP服务器(可以匿名访问),借助它中继访问公共的邮件服务(通过向公共邮件服务提供认证信息)。具体步骤如下:

1. 安装 SMTP 服务器

选择添加功能,然后一路next直到安装即可

2. 搜索并确实outlook.com 的SMTP服务器信息

http://www.outlook-apps.com/outlook-com-pop-settings/

OUTLOOK.COM POP3 SERVERS

Incoming mail server

pop3.live.com

Incoming mail server port

995 (SSL required)

Outgoing (SMTP) mail server

smtp.live.com

Outgoing (SMTP) mail server port

587 (SSL/TLS required)

Outgoing server (SMTP) authentication

yes, same settings as my incoming mail server

3. 配置SMTP服务器

3.1 设置服务器的IP地址

3.2 启用匿名访问

由于SharePoint的传出邮件只能访问匿名的SMTP服务器,所从必须启用匿名访问

3.3 设置连接控制和中继限制—允许所有机器连接和中继

3.4 设置此SMTP服务器访问outlook.com SMTP服务器的验证信息

由于outlook.com的SMTP服务是不允许匿名访问的,所以必须设置访问的用户名密码

3.5 设置连接outlook.com SMTP服务器的端口

由于outlook.com的SMTP用的不是默认的25端口,所以需设置其特定的端口:587

3.6 设置outlook.com对应的SMTP服务器: smtp.live.com

4. 设置防火墙:新建端口为25的入站规则

5. 重置IIS并启动SMTP服务

4.1 执行IISReset 命令

4.2 重启SMTP服务

6. 测试SMTP服务器

安装成功后,可从使用outlook进行简单的测试,其是正常工作的

打钩,说明SMTP服务器配置成功

7. 在管理中心设置传出邮件

到此,邮件通知已经配置成为。

Note: 部分SMTP服务器不允许匿名发件人,所以请把From address 和Reply address改成outlook.com的账户:WinAzureTrial6850@live.com

当然我们也可以将我们的SMTP发布到公网供大家使用: 在Windows Azure的管理门户发布25端口

参考文章:

http://brandonatkinson.blogspot.se/2012/08/configure-sharepoint-2010-outgoing.html

http://www.vsysad.com/2012/04/setup-and-configure-smtp-server-on-windows-server-2008-r2/

http://www.outlook-apps.com/outlook-com-pop-settings

基于Windows Azure 搭建基于SharePoint 2010 Intranet、Extranet、Internet (4): 配置传出邮件服务: 使用 outlook.com 发送邮件通知的更多相关文章

  1. 如何使用新浪微博账户进行应用登录验证(基于Windows Azure Mobile Service 集成登录验证)

    使用三方账号登录应用应该对大家来说已经不是什么新鲜事儿了,但是今天为什么还要在这里跟大家聊这个话题呢,原因很简单 Windows Azure Mobiles Service Authenticatio ...

  2. [转]Windows Azure上安装SharePoint 2013

    基于Windows Azure 安装SharePoint 2013 前段时间写的基于Windows Azure安装SharePoint系列,由于Azure的体验账号过期了,所以不得不暂停.今天有幸参加 ...

  3. 快速学习使用 Windows Azure 上的 SharePoint Server 2013

     为了在当今的企业环境中占据一席之地,您需要能够迅速顺应变化和应对挑战.有时,需要及时调整您的SharePoint 基础结构以保持竞争优势. 基础结构即服务可通过随时使用.即付即用的解决方案应对这 ...

  4. 基于Windows Azure 安装 SharePoint 2010简体中文语言包

    在Windows Azure上安装的Windows Server默认是英文版本的,当时安装的SharePoint也是英文版的,为方便使用,决定安装中文的语言包,具体过程如下: 1. 安装 Window ...

  5. windows azure Vm、cloud service、web application 如何选择可用的服务

    windows azure 的web应用和虚拟机都经常用.我们经常把我们的网站部署上去.一般选择web应用或者开一个虚拟机.开一个虚拟机就会按照虚拟机的使用时间进行计费. 那么我们选择web部署在哪里 ...

  6. Windows Azure功能更新:弹性伸缩(autoscale)、监控报警、移动服务及网站服务商用、新的虚拟机镜像

    Windows Azure功能又更新了.此次更新包括1项重要更新和两个功能更新: 重要更新:云服务.网站支持按策略进行弹性伸缩 功能更新:两个预览版的服务(网站和移动)进入商用,虚拟机服务支持SQL ...

  7. 基于windows平台搭建elasticsearch

    部署准备 elasticsearch-6.0.1.zip--https://www.elastic.co/downloads/elasticsearch elasticsearch-head-mast ...

  8. 在Windows下搭建基于nginx的视频直播和点播系统

    http://my.oschina.net/gaga/blog/478480 一.软件准备 由于nginx原生是为linux服务的,因此官方并没有编译好的windows版本可以下载,要在windows ...

  9. Windows下搭建基于SSH的Git服务器

    Git客户端安装 客户端要同时安装在远程服务器和自己的电脑上,下载地址:http://msysgit.github.io/ 选择安装组件 :也可以默认选择; 图标组件(Addition icons) ...

随机推荐

  1. BZOJ 2829 凸包

    思路: 把信用卡周围去掉  只剩下中间的长方形 最后的答案加上一个圆 //By SiriusRen #include <bits/stdc++.h> using namespace std ...

  2. Sql Server 如何解决多并发情况下,出现的多个相同ID数据

    在数据库中单独创建一张表,保存当前存储状态,“存储过程”  设置访问条件root初始值为“0” 如果root值不为0的时候就不可访问并进行相关操作. 在事务执行前将root值设置为1,事务结束后将ro ...

  3. eclipse安装python开发pydev插件

    eclipse安装python开发pydev插件 下载eclipse的python开发插件pydev http://pan.baidu.com/s/1qXHt8pI 下载python.exe,并安装. ...

  4. 如何用windbg查看_eprocess结构

    打开菜单: File->Symbol File Path... 输入: C:/MyCodesSymbols; SRV*C:/MyLocalSymbols*http://msdl.microsof ...

  5. 10java内存

    java内存 1.栈---存储的是变量(不仅仅只有变量),不会对存储的内容进行赋值,存储的内容使用完成之后会立即进行清除 2.堆---存储的是对象.会对存储的内容进行赋值,存储内容使用完成之后会在某个 ...

  6. Netty 长连接服务

    转自:https://www.dozer.cc/2014/12/netty-long-connection.html 推送服务 还记得一年半前,做的一个项目需要用到 Android 推送服务.和 iO ...

  7. Vector 和 Array 区别

    1:array 定义的时候必须定义数组的元素个数;而vector 不需要:且只能包含整型字面值常量,枚举常量或者用常量表达式初始化的整型const对象, 非const变量以及需要到运行阶段才知道其值的 ...

  8. 学习MPI并行编程记录

    简单的MPI程序示例 首先,我们来看一个简单的MPI程序实例.如同我们学习各种语言的第一个程序一样,对于MPI的第一个程序同样是"Hello Word". /* Case 1 he ...

  9. Linux下源码安装Peach-2.3.8教程

    在peach文件夹下运行 python peach.py ./samples/HelloWorld.xml 提示先安装4Suite-XML. 根据提示在dependences文件夹下安装,出现两次错误 ...

  10. PAT 1097. Deduplication on a Linked List (链表)

    Given a singly linked list L with integer keys, you are supposed to remove the nodes with duplicated ...